Joining Confirmation Letter.

  Joining Confirmation Letter. Date: 00/00/0000 To The Director-HR Name of Organization Subject: Joining Confirmation Letter.   Dear Sir/Madam,   I am pleased to inform you that I have officially joined [name of organization] as a [name of position] in the [name of office], under the [name of the program], effective today, 00/00/0000. I am truly grateful for this opportunity to be part of such a prestigious organization and am excited about the potential for a rewarding career with [name of organization]. I look forward to your support and guidance as I navigate the onboarding process and induction.  Crafting and Enhancing Your Resume, CV, Cover Letter, and LinkedIn Profile

In the competitive job market, a well-crafted resume, CV, cover letter, and LinkedIn profile are essential tools for showcasing your skills and experience to potential employers. These documents play a crucial role in making a strong first impression and setting you on the path to professional success. Here's a comprehensive guide on how to write and upgrade these crucial components of your career journey:




1. Resume/CV:

  • Clarity and Brevity: Start with a clear and concise summary of your career goals and highlight your key qualifications. Use a bulleted list to list your accomplishments and responsibilities, making it easier for employers to read.
  • Tailoring: Customize your resume/CV for each job application. Highlight relevant skills and experience that match the job description.
  • Quantifiable Achievements: Use specific metrics to quantify your achievements. For example, mention how you increased sales by a certain percentage or reduced project completion time.
  • Keyword Optimization: Incorporate industry-related keywords to increase the likelihood of passing through automated applicant tracking systems (ATS).
  • Education and Experience: Clearly list your educational background and work experience in reverse chronological order. Include job titles, company names, dates, and a brief description of your roles.
  • Skills: Include both technical and soft skills that are relevant to the job you're applying for.
  • Formatting: Choose a clean and professional layout. Use consistent fonts and bullet points for easy readability.

2. Cover Letter:

  • Customization: Address the cover letter to the hiring manager and mention the specific position you're applying for.
  • Introduction: Begin with a strong opening that captures the reader's attention and explains your interest in the company and the role.
  • Relevance: Highlight how your skills and experiences align with the company's values and the job requirements.
  • Storytelling: Share a brief anecdote that illustrates a relevant accomplishment or skill.
  • Value Proposition: Explain how you can contribute to the company's success and why you're the ideal candidate for the position.
  • Closing: Conclude by expressing enthusiasm for the opportunity to interview and thanking the reader for considering your application.

3. LinkedIn Profile:

  • Professional Headline: Craft a headline that clearly states your current role or career aspirations.
  • Summary: Write a compelling summary that showcases your expertise, career goals, and what you bring to the table.
  • Experience: Detail your work experience, similar to your resume/CV. Include accomplishments, responsibilities, and any projects you've worked on.
  • Skills and Endorsements: List relevant skills and encourage colleagues to endorse them. This adds credibility to your profile.
  • Referrals: Get referrals from colleagues, managers, or clients who can vouch for your skills and work ethic.
  • Engagement: Share industry-related content, articles, and your own insights to demonstrate your expertise and engagement.
  • Professional photos: Use high-quality photos that present you professionally.

4. Continuous Improvement:

  • Regular Updates: Keep your resume, CV, cover letter, and LinkedIn profile up to date as you gain new skills and experiences.
  • Feedback: Seek feedback from mentors, peers, or career advisors to ensure your documents are polished and effective.
  • Learning and Development: Invest in professional development opportunities that enhance your skills and qualifications.
  • Stay Relevant: Stay informed about industry trends and adapt your documents accordingly.

In conclusion, investing time and effort into crafting and enhancing your resume, CV, cover letter, and LinkedIn profile can significantly boost your chances of landing your desired job. By tailoring these documents to your strengths and the specific requirements of each application, you'll position yourself as a standout candidate in the eyes of potential employers.
